Analysis of Bio-heat Transfer Problem Using Finite Element Approach

Bio-heat transfer is the study of external or internal heat transfer in the biological body. In different therapeutic treatments especially in cancer treatment, heat is used to cure infected cells. The required temperature that will kill the infected cell should be known before starting the thermal treatment on human tissue. An Application of the Finite Volume Method to the Bio-heat-transfer-equation in Premature Infants

Abstract. In this report the development of a finite volume method for the time-accurate simulation of the temperature distribution in a premature infant inside an incubator or in an open radiant warmer is described.
